What Is a Call Center Representative Job?

A call center representative job is a customer service role that involves receiving and making phone calls to customers or clients. Call center representatives are responsible for answering customer inquiries, resolving complaints, and providing information about products and services. These jobs require excellent communication skills, empathy, and a willingness to work in a fast-paced environment.

Call center representative jobs are in high demand all over the U.S, and Maryland is no exception. Maryland has a bustling call center industry, with many reputable companies offering hundreds of call center representative jobs.

What Are the Requirements for a Call Center Representative Job in Maryland?

While the specific requirements may vary depending on the company and the position, most call center representative jobs in Maryland require a high school diploma or a GED, as well as excellent communication and computer skills. Some companies may require prior experience in customer service, while others offer on-the-job training. Additionally, some call center representative positions may require a flexible schedule, as call centers often operate 24/7.

What Are the Benefits of Working in a Call Center in Maryland?

Working in a call center in Maryland can be a rewarding and fulfilling career choice, with many benefits. For starters, call center representative jobs offer competitive salaries and benefits packages, including health insurance, retirement plans, and paid time off. Additionally, call center representatives have the opportunity to interact with a diverse group of people, learn about new products and services, and develop their communication and problem-solving skills. Furthermore, call center representatives are often eligible for career advancement opportunities within the company, including management positions.
